Is 2(6 – 3x) + x equivalent to 2(3x) + x + 12?

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

Carry out indicated operations to see if they are equal

2(6-3x)+x=2(3x)+x+12

2(6)+2(-3x)+x=6x+x+12

12-6x+x=6x+x+12 combine like terms on both sides

12-5x=12+7x (we can see here they are unequal but we can continue) subtract 12 from both sides

-5x=7x divide both sides by x

-5=7

7 is not equal to -5 so the original expressions aren’t equivalent.
